Hero Discontinues Xpulse 200T and Xtreme 200S- New Models on the Horizon

googleAdd CarBike360 on Google

Hero MotoCorp has discontinued the Xpulse 200T and Xtreme 200S motorcycles due to low demand. The company is now focusing on launching new models like the Xpulse 210 and Xtreme 250.

Hero MotoCorp, the largest 2-wheeler manufacturer in the world, has officially discontinued two motorcycle models from its collection. These discontinued bikes are the Xpulse 200T and Xtreme200S. This move is a part of the company’s strategy to focus on more successful models in the future.

Reasons for the Discontinuation 

The primary reason for the company to discontinue these bikes from its lineup is that these motorcycles were struggling to gain traction in the Indian market. Additionally, they failed to get a similar level of popularity to their sibling Xpulse 200 off-roader. However, the company recently introduced some upgrades to these models such as a four-valve engine from the Xtreme 200S but still, these models had not generated sufficient sales volumes to continue the production of these bikes. Consequently, the company made this decision which reflects Hero’s response to low demand and declined sales performance.

Future Plans of Hero MotoCorp

Hero MotoCorp is actively working on expanding its premium motorcycle lineup. The company is set to introduce new models such as the Xpulse 210, which was showcased at EICMA earlier this year. The upcoming Xpulse 210 will feature enhanced power, performance, and features, which makes it a worthy successor to the existing models. According to the updates, Hero will add the following models to the lineup soon- Xtreme 250, Karizma ZMR 250, and Variants of the Maverick 440.

These new models are expected to provide a more compelling experience for buyers and align with Hero's goal of establishing a premium motorcycle presence.
